craziness的意思
craziness
['krezɪnɪs]
n. 愚蠢;狂热;摇摇晃晃
中频词
英文词源
craziness (n.)
c. 1600, "infirmity," from crazy + -ness. Meaning "state of being flawed or damaged" is from 1660s; that of mental unsoundness" is from 1755.
双语例句
1. We had to have a sense of humour because of the
craziness
of it all.
它的种种疯狂让我们不得不表现出幽默感。
来自柯林斯例句
2. Leo held himself to be a critic of
craziness
.
利奥把自己看成是一名疯狂症的鉴定家.
来自辞典例句
3. You can see his
craziness
and his cunningness both in his face.
在他的脸上你可以同时看到他的愚蠢和狡猾.
来自互联网
4. Once you have this
craziness
, you can achieve anything you want.
一旦你具有疯狂的精神, 你就能成就你所要的任何事.
来自互联网
5. There is a fine dinstinction between ingenuity and
craziness
.
机智与疯狂之间有些细微的差别.
